Output 95455794a014ecf829e60d08291baa4c261611808a4cabb96c8032813513938e:0

value
28589441
script pubkey
OP_0 OP_PUSHBYTES_20 1f5b47a5d80ab1b25255eb58e7a1ee214fa806b7
address
bc1qrad50fwcp2cmy5j4advw0g0wy986sp4hcyn2pc
transaction
95455794a014ecf829e60d08291baa4c261611808a4cabb96c8032813513938e
spent
true